CIAA fines 16 gazetted officers
The Commission for Investigation of Abuse of Authority (CIAA) has fined 16 gazetted officers including a joint-secretary for not furnishing their property details.
Joint Secretary at the Department Forest Research and Survey Mrigendra Bhusal and section officers Anita Niraula, Laxman Lamichhane, Sharad Kumar Baral, Arjun Baral, Devendra Lal Karna, Rajn Regmi, Basanta Sharma, Bimal Kumar Acharya, Dharma Chandra Shakya, Laxman Kumar Shrestha, Hari Prasad Joshi, Urmila Kafle and Pitamber Bajgain have been fined Rs. 5,000 each for not furnishing their property details. CIAA has also directed them to furnish their property details within 30 days.
According to Corruption Control Act, anyone holding a public position should furnish his/her property details within sixty days of the end of a fiscal year.
It is learnt that Prime Minister Pushpa Kamal Dahal and seven ministers of his cabinet have also not filed their property details. They should have filed their property details by October 31, 2008, as per the provisions of the Act. CIAA has not mentioned anything about why it had not fined the ministers. nepalnews.com Feb 06 09
